The GEO Group (NYSE: GEO) (GEO) announced today that it has entered into a new two-year lease agreement, with successive two-year renewal option periods through October 31, 2041, with the State of New Mexico at the company-owned, 600-bed Guadalupe County Correctional Facility.

- GEO has operated the Guadalupe County Correctional Facility under a management contract with New Mexico and will transition facility operations to the New Mexico Corrections Department when the new lease agreement commences on November 1, 2021.
- GEO will retain responsibility for facility maintenance throughout the term of the lease.
- For the first six months ended June 30, 2021, the Guadalupe County Correctional Facility generated operating revenue of approximately $4 million.
